Environment:

Ramsden and Entwistle (1981) empirically identified arelationship between approaches to learning and perceivedcharacteristics of the academic environment. Haertela, Walberg, andHaertela (1981) found correlations between student perceptions ofsocial psychological environments of their classes and learningoutcomes. Web-based technology has noticeably transformed thelearning and teaching environment. Proponents of online learninghave seen that it can be effective in potentially eliminatingbarriers while providing increased convenience, flexibility,currency of material, customized learning, and feedback over atraditional face-to-face A. Ya Ni Journal of Public AffairsEducation 201 experience (Hackbarth, 1996; Harasim, 1990; Kiser,1999; Matthews, 1999; Swan et al., 2000). Opponents, however, areconcerned that students in an online environment may feel isolated(Brown, 1996), confused, and frustrated (Hara & Kling, 2000)and that student’s interest in the subject and learningeffectiveness may be reduced (R. Maki, W. Maki, Patterson, &Whittaker, 2000)
